Softheon to Host Webinar to Provide An Insightful Look Into What's Ahead In the Era of Health Insurance Marketplaces

STONY BROOK, N.Y., Jan. 16,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Softheon, Inc., a leader of health insurance marketplace integration and business operation, announced today that it will be hosting a live webinar featuring Gartner titled "A Look into What's Ahead In the Era of Health Insurance Marketplaces," on Wednesday, January 29, 2014 at 12:00 pm ET. Speakers of this webinar include Softheon Founder and CEO, Eugene Sayan and Gartner Vice President and Distinguished Analyst, Robert Booz.

With over 2.2 Million Americans enrolled in coverage, PPACA has received an overwhelming positive response, effectively reducing the nation's 47 Million uninsured. With less than 90 days, health plans must seize this opportunity and effectively reach individuals still uninsured within their state and service areas by the close of open enrollment this March. However, while striving to fulfill this commitment, health plans must recognize and understand that although the troubled rollout is behind us, the possibility of experiencing forthcoming fundamental issues could persist.

Softheon Marketplace Connector Cloud (MC2) works with 38 regional health plans to integrate its plan management, eligibility & enrollment, SHOP, premium billing and customer service solutions along with core administrative platforms. Softheon MC2 is an integration platform between the FFM and Carrier existing business processes and IT systems. Softheon MC2 operates with minimal risk and is in full compliance with the Affordable Care Act (ACA). Softheon has enrolled over 50,000 exchange members as of January 1, 2014 in 40 states – generating over $36 million dollars in revenues for its carriers.

"Healthcare payers and other stakeholders in the U.S. healthcare system clearly recognize that health insurance reform — and particularly the health insurance exchanges mandated by the U.S. Affordable Care Act (ACA) — are now a reality. Many technical difficulties remain, as the troubled rollout of the federal government's healthcare.gov website shows, but the legal, political and cultural barriers to reform have largely been overcome. This means that healthcare payers will now have more time — and more resources, in terms of budgets and skills — to prepare for what will certainly be a radically different healthcare landscape," wrote Robert Booz in the November 2013, report, Predicts 2014: New Landscape Demands New Business and IT Approaches for Healthcare Payers.
